Anyone else have skiddish cats?
I have 3 cats. I got 1 cat, Poopie in June of 02. In Nov 03 we decided to get her a playmate, and well, ended up bringing 2 more home, Smokey and Oreo.
Anyway, Smokey and Oreo are sisters. When we got them, they were about 9 or 10 weeks old. As kittens, they were always by each others side. Sleeping together, eating together, and playing together. Smokey has always been the more dominant cat, and Oreo was, and still is always skiddish.
Oreo seemed nervous the day we brought her home, but we figured w/ time and getting used to us, it would go away. She has gotten a bit better, but is still a very very skiddish cat even after 4 years.
She has opened up as much as possible to my hubby and I. She constantly comes around, meows, and stuts her stuff, as if she were saying "here I am, pet me, love me". But the minute you reach your hand to pet her, she usually freaks out and bolts, often hiding under any furniture that will keep her safe from anyone grabbing her. Very seldom do I get to pet her w/ my hand. The odd thing is if she is laying in a spot that is just in reach of being able to pet her with my foot, she is fine. Hubby and I can rub her all over w/ our feet, and she seems to enjoy this very much. She has fear of being held, so I think that's why she enjoys the "feet rubs" so much. Anytime I am actually able to grab her and hold her, she cowers in a ball, and shakes the whole time. I often wonder if she was abused as a young kitten before we got her, but the fact is her sister is fine, and the reputable shelter we got her from had no knowledge of any abuse, or atleast there were no signs of it. The odd thing being she is not afraid of our feet, I think if I were a cat, I'd be afraid of being kicked! Lol. Oreo also has no problem coming and sleeping in bed with us. She seems to wait until it is dark and the TV is off, then she will come and lay next to me and purrs.
We have been through 2 moves since we got her. The moves though never seem to really bother her too much. She seems to get used to her new digs quite quickly. Its just so odd that she struts around looking for attention, then bolts the minutes we try to give her some.
Also, another odd thing to point out, is when we do get to pet her w/ our hands, she enjoys getting spanked. I know it sounds odd, but Oreo and her sister Smokey enjoy getting smacked on the butt area above the tail, and the side of the hind legs. I know some cats like getting scratched, but these ones actually enjoy smacks. Its so weird!
Anyways, advice please?
